What to Do After a Car Accident

The moments immediately following a car accident can be chaotic, but it's important to understand that the actions you take can greatly impact your legal claim. Important details can be forgotten, and crucial evidence and witnesses can disappear. Here's what to do after a car accident:

  • Call 911 and report the incident so a police report can be made.
  • Don't admit fault, and don't place blame.
  • Exchange your contact info, as well as driver's license and insurance paperwork with others at the scene of the accident.
  • Write down what you remember about the crash—especially what happened directly before the accident.
  • Don't give a written or verbal statement to the insurance companies.

Types of Accidents

Road conditions caused by Erie's snowy winters, dangerous intersections, careless drivers—those who drive distracted and drunk—and other factors caused more than 2,700 crashes last year in Erie County. According to the latest statistics, people were injured in nearly 1,300 crashes, 27 of which were fatal.

Types of Injuries

Some car accident injuries are apparent right away, while others may take days or even weeks for symptoms to appear. Sometimes, an injury may seem minor, but in reality may require surgery and other extensive medical treatment. Head and Brain Injuries

Head and brain injuries are some of the most common and serious suffered by car accident victims. Whiplash, coma, concussion, and traumatic brain injuries can change your life forever, requiring costly medical treatment that can span months, years, or a lifetime.

Shoulder Injuries

Injuries to your shoulder can cause more than just pain and discomfort—they can also lead to surgery, which could affect everything from your ability to work to your ability to participate in sports and other activities you once enjoyed.

Neck, Back, and Spinal Cord Injuries

Car accident victims who've hurt their neck, back, or spinal cord often don't immediately realize the extent of their injuries. Spinal cord injuries are especially scary because they can cause partial or even complete paralysis.

Knee Injuries

A knee injury can affect your life long after a car accident. Knee, ankle, and other types of leg injuries can require surgery, physical therapy, and ultimately the use of braces, crutches, and even a wheelchair. They can also affect your ability to work and complete everyday tasks like driving. Knee injuries can also make you more susceptible to conditions such as arthritis as you get older.
